The ROHM IGBT contribute to energy saving high efficiency and a wide range of high voltage and high current applications. The IGBT features a low collector to emitter saturation voltage, making it highly efficient for various applications. It offers a short circuit withstand time of 5 microseconds, ensuring robust performance under fault conditions. Additionally, it is equipped with a built in very fast and soft recovery fast recovery diode from the RFN series.
Low Switching Loss
Pb free lead plating
RoHS compliant
